Memory, cores and disk can all be raised on the same server later, usually within the hour, with no rebuild and no new IP address — so starting one size below the estimate is normally the cheaper mistake.

Which tiers suit Property Developers
Including the ones that do not, and why — that is usually the more useful half.
| Infrastructure | Verdict | Why |
|---|---|---|
| Shared Hosting Managed space on a shared server | Workable | Workable for a single small property or practice, though a shared database is the first thing to strain when bookings cluster. |
| VPS Flexible virtual infrastructure with full root access | Recommended | A VPS handles a booking engine and its database comfortably, with predictable performance when enquiries spike. |
| VDS Virtual server with resources pinned to you alone | Recommended | Pinned resources matter here: a reservation that times out at the payment step is a booking you never see. |
| Dedicated Server An entire physical server, configured to your specification | Workable | Right once you are running several properties, or a property management system alongside the public site. |
| Bare Metal Physical compute for sustained, demanding workloads | Not this one | Reservation workloads are database-bound rather than compute-bound, so the extra physical capacity goes unused. |
